All,
I have been working on a concept for linking very simple Packet nodes (a
TNC, Radio, Internet connection and minimal Win 9X or Linux CPU)with
WL2K's
Telnet servers. This could offer the wide coverage, standard email with
attachments, and rapid forwarding of the internet with the wireless
"last
mile" performance of packet. Will let you know when this gets closer to
reality. We have to do something like this to keep packet alive!

One of my ham friends who lives in his motor home and travels around the
country ....
"Regular packet is all but dead here in Tucson, the birthplace of
packet. I
hear one station beaconing on 01, and he is beaconing an APRS location.
It
is a TCP/IP station that I can't connect to and I see him over on 144.39
with the same beacon. I guess he can't set the beacons different on
different ports."
So, we have a lot of work to do.
